r/isthisabearingwall Lounge
Don’t trust random people on the internet for building advice. Assume every wall is bearing until someone with a lot of experience looks. I am a carpenter, I personally have installed hundreds of bearing legs under girders in houses in walls where that point is the only bearing member. The issue is this can easily appear to be a non bearing wall that collapses your ceiling if you try to demo it. To that end the point of this sub is not to answer the title question, it’s to tell you not to ask.
